TECHNICAL SERVICES

We at IFS regard our Technical Services Division as a key element in the package we offer to all our customers.

Our back-up goes beyond the normal warranties or maintenance to include training, inspections, advice and long-term contracts – because it is our business to see that you get the best from your investment... not just this week or this year, but throughout its working life.

Our involvement begins before purchase (we advise on printroom practice, floorspace efficiency and the best machines for the job) and continues with training and life-long maintenance and servicing. We serve the whole of England, Scotland, Ireland and Wales through our network of strategically-based engineers, with the vast majority of calls receiving attention within eight working hours. Stocks of spare parts are held by our engineers around the country and at our main warehouse in Perivale, Middlesex.

We are also able to set up special priority maintenance contracts tailored to your particular needs. And even when everything is running sweetly our sophisticated Service Management computer system is working to help us anticipate your problems and deal with them before they arise.

Preventive Maintenance

More and more of our customers are experiencing the benefits of our Preventive Maintenance Contracts. As well as ensuring the maximum return on your investment through optimum operational efficiency, reduced downtime and higher value retention, these contracts can also offer discounts on spare parts and consumables, priority response status and the opportunity to plan your maintenance budget one, two, three or more years in advance. Your Maintenance Contract is tailored to the specific requirements of your equipment configuration, operating on your product, in your working environment and can vary from the basic annual check-up to a Total Cost Cover agreement that means you never have to pay another penny towards its repair or maintenance, regardless of the circumstances. Variations on the standard contract may include out-of-hours telephone assistance, 24-hour call-out stand-by and emergency operator cover. We are also able offer operator training for our equipment at your site or at our Perivale Showroom.

Emergency Call-Outs

If emergency assistance is required following a machine breakdown at any time – day or night – contact our Technical Services Department immediately. To help us to help you with the maximum efficiency and the minimum delay, please be sure to have the following information available when you call:

  • your company name
  • location (with postcode)
  • telephone number
  • machine manufacturer
  • model type
  • serial number
  • description of problem
  • any relevant history

We will then assess the situation and take the appropriate measures to get you back in production as quickly as possible.
